Lasik Recovery Time - Eyes start healing immediately after lasik, but you will likely experience blurriness and other fluctuations in your vision following surgery. How long is lasik recovery? As your eyes completely heal, you’ll gradually notice your vision improving. However, certain factors may affect a person’s recovery time. Immediately following the surgery, patients often experience blurred vision and watery eyes. It can take up to six months for people’s vision to fully stabilize. The time it takes to recover from lasik surgery varies from person to person.
